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Condom to Strasbourg is to bus which costs €75 - €150 and takes 19h 42m.
The fastest way to get from Condom to Strasbourg is to bus and train and fly which takes 6h 24m and costs €100 - €270.
No, there is no direct bus from Condom to Strasbourg. However, there are services departing from CONDOM - Gare Routière and arriving at Strasbourg via AUCH - Allées Baylac, Toulouse - Matabiau Bus Station and Montpellier.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 19h 42m.
The distance between Condom and Strasbourg is 1168 km. The road distance is 929.7 km.
The best way to get from Condom to Strasbourg without a car is to bus and train via Antony which takes 8h 50m and costs €210 - €390.
It takes approximately 8h 50m to get from Condom to Strasbourg, including transfers.
Condom to Strasbourg bus services, operated by liO Car Gers (Région Occitanie), depart from CONDOM - Gare Routière station.
Condom to Strasbourg bus services, operated by liO Car Gers (Région Occitanie), arrive at AUCH - Allées Baylac station.
Yes, the driving distance between Condom to Strasbourg is 930 km. It takes approximately 10h 34m to drive from Condom to Strasbourg.
